THE new Polo is about to get bigger! Auto Express understands that Volkswagen is planning a fresh compact MPV based on its supermini.
Plugging a vital gap in the manufacturer’s range, a Polo people carrier would be ideal for buyers seeking to downsize from the larger Touran. Its chief rival is likely to be the Vauxhall Meriva.
The car will enable VW to compete in an ever-expanding market sector: as well as the Meriva, Nissan’s Note has proved a hit, while Ford is set to launch a B-MAX mini-MPV, too. A flexible cabin with sliding seats and a twin-height boot floor would set the car apart.
The newcomer is due on sale within two years, powered by common-rail diesel engines or small-capacity TSI turbo petrols. VW is also likely to offer an eco-friendly BlueMotion variant.
